Join Tiny Jenny, a mischievous fairy born to a family of wrens, as she sets out to find where she truly belongs.
Mr and Mrs Wren are surprised when a tiny, wingless fairy hatches from one of their eggs. But they lovingly name her Tiny Jenny and raise her as their own. Tiny Jenny – like all fairies – grows to be a menace in the woods. She digs up squirrel nuts and blocks mole hills. The other forest creatures are not happy. So Tiny Jenny decides it is time to leave her home and seek out her fairy family. But it turns out the fairies are anything but welcoming! Oh, where does Tiny Jenny truly belong?

Author: Briony May Smith
►Reading Age: 3 to 7 Years
Details: Hardcover | 48 pages | 27.5 x 25.0 cm
►About the Author: Briony May Smith graduated from Falmouth University with a First Class degree in Illustration. Since then, she has been shortlisted for the British Comic Awards and has been twice highly commended for the Macmillan Children’s Prize. She is inspired by traditional fairy tales and folklore, and by the farm she lives on in Devon.
